The inclusion of ships will further increase the capabilities of Pakistan Navy

Romania: Naval Chief Admiral Amjad Khan Niazi has said that Navy will be equipped with latest weapons and technology.
Addressing a ceremony as a chief guest at the Demon Shipyard in Romania, he said the inclusion of ships will further increase the capabilities of Pakistan Navy to protect maritime affairs.
According to the Navy's spokesperson, work has started to develop two modern offshore patrol warships for Pakistan Navy in Romania's Demon Shipyard.
